Default Vista wireless drivers

Hello,

I work at a college and students are bringing their new laptops with Vista
(all different version) into the Help Desk because they can't connect to our
wireless network. They connect to the access points, get an IP address, but
can't go anywhere. Google comes up and you can search for anything and get a
response, but when you click on a link it just sits there and doesn't go
anywhere. We have contacted our wireless vendor and they said it is an issue
with Vista or a driver.

On older cards (Intel 2200ABG) it works just fine. We tried doing a "fresh"
install of Vista and still can't connect. Finally we tried an XP driver on
the card (Intel 3945ABG) with a computer running Vista and we can connect
just fine now. However this is just a work around and doesn't make any sense
at all why we have to revert back to XP when we are running Vista.

Any help or insite on this issue would be greatly appreciated. Thank You.
